/freebsd/contrib/sendmail/libsmutil/ |
H A D | safefile.c | 45 safefile(fn, uid, gid, user, flags, mode, st) 48 GID_T gid; variable 64 fn, (int) uid, (int) gid, flags, mode); 115 gid = st->st_gid; 128 ret = safedirpath(".", uid, gid, user, 134 ret = safedirpath(fn, uid, gid, user, 218 if (stbuf.st_gid == gid) 332 if (st->st_gid == gid) 396 GID_T gid; 578 ret = safedirpath(target, uid, gid, user, flags, [all …]
|
/freebsd/usr.sbin/pw/ |
H A D | pw_vpw.c | 151 vnextgrent(char const *nam, gid_t gid, int doclose) in vnextgrent() argument 174 if (gid != (gid_t)-1) { in vnextgrent() 175 if (gid == gr->gr_gid) in vnextgrent() 201 vgetgrgid(gid_t gid) in vgetgrgid() argument 203 return vnextgrent(NULL, gid, 1); in vgetgrgid()
|
H A D | pw_group.c | 177 gid_t gid = (gid_t) - 1; in gr_gidpolicy() local 183 gid = (gid_t) id; in gr_gidpolicy() 185 if ((grp = GETGRGID(gid)) != NULL && conf.checkduplicate) in gr_gidpolicy() 188 return (gid); in gr_gidpolicy() 216 gid = (gid_t) (bm_firstunset(&bm) + cnf->min_gid); in gr_gidpolicy() 218 gid = (gid_t) (bm_lastset(&bm) + 1); in gr_gidpolicy() 219 if (!bm_isset(&bm, gid)) in gr_gidpolicy() 220 gid += cnf->min_gid; in gr_gidpolicy() 222 gid = (gid_t) (bm_firstunset(&bm) + cnf->min_gid); in gr_gidpolicy() 228 if (gid < cnf->min_gid || gid > cnf->max_gid) in gr_gidpolicy() [all …]
|
/freebsd/contrib/smbfs/mount_smbfs/ |
H A D | mount_smbfs.c | 87 gid_t gid; in main() local 95 gid = (gid_t)-1; in main() 162 gid = grp->gr_gid; in main() 242 if (gid == (gid_t)-1) in main() 243 gid = st.st_gid; in main() 260 ctx->ct_ssn.ioc_group = ctx->ct_sh.ioc_group = gid; in main() 283 build_iovec_argf(&iov, &iovlen, "gid", "%d", gid); in main()
|
/freebsd/crypto/heimdal/lib/ipc/ |
H A D | common.c | 45 gid_t gid; member 65 return cred->gid; in heim_ipc_cred_get_gid() 82 _heim_ipc_create_cred(uid_t uid, gid_t gid, pid_t pid, pid_t session, heim_icred *cred) in _heim_ipc_create_cred() argument 88 (*cred)->gid = gid; in _heim_ipc_create_cred()
|
/freebsd/cddl/contrib/opensolaris/cmd/dtrace/test/tst/common/scripting/ |
H A D | tst.gid.ksh | 54 /\$gid != \$1/ 60 /\$gid == \$1/ 72 groupid=`ps -x -o pid,gid | grep "$$ " | awk '{print $2}' 2>/dev/null`
|
/freebsd/tools/test/stress2/misc/ |
H A D | killpg.sh | 59 static pid_t gid, pid; 122 if ((gid = fork()) == 0) 127 if (killpg(gid, SIGINFO) == -1) { 146 if ((gid = fork()) == 0)
|
/freebsd/usr.bin/login/ |
H A D | login_fbtab.c | 80 login_fbtab(char *tty, uid_t uid, gid_t gid) in login_fbtab() argument 110 login_protect(table, cp, prot, uid, gid); in login_fbtab() 120 login_protect(const char *table, char *pattern, int mask, uid_t uid, gid_t gid) in login_protect() argument 135 if (chown(path, uid, gid) && errno != ENOENT) in login_protect()
|
/freebsd/contrib/sendmail/libsm/ |
H A D | sem.c | 222 sm_semsetowner(int semid, uid_t uid, gid_t gid, MODE_T mode) in sm_semsetowner() argument 225 sm_semsetowner(semid, uid, gid, mode) in sm_semsetowner() 228 gid_t gid; 245 semidds.sem_perm.gid = gid;
|
/freebsd/lib/libutil/ |
H A D | _secure_path.c | 43 _secure_path(const char *path, uid_t uid, gid_t gid) in _secure_path() argument 64 } else if ((int)gid != -1 && sb.st_gid != gid && (sb.st_mode & S_IWGRP)) in _secure_path()
|
/freebsd/contrib/libarchive/libarchive/test/ |
H A D | test_write_format_mtree.c | 35 gid_t gid; member 55 gid_t gid; member 97 archive_entry_set_gid(ae, entries[i].gid); in test_write_format_mtree_sub() 98 assert(entries[i].gid == archive_entry_gid(ae)); in test_write_format_mtree_sub() 149 assertEqualInt(entries[i].gid, archive_entry_gid(ae)); in test_write_format_mtree_sub() 185 archive_entry_set_gid(ae, entries2[i].gid); in test_write_format_mtree_sub2() 186 assert(entries2[i].gid == archive_entry_gid(ae)); in test_write_format_mtree_sub2() 239 assertEqualInt(entries2[i].gid, archive_entry_gid(ae)); in test_write_format_mtree_sub2()
|
/freebsd/contrib/ofed/infiniband-diags/src/ |
H A D | ibdiag_sa.c | 77 int sa_set_handle(struct sa_handle * handle, int grh_present, ibmad_gid_t *gid) in sa_set_handle() argument 80 if (gid == NULL) { in sa_set_handle() 84 memcpy(handle->dport.gid, gid, 16); in sa_set_handle() 132 memcpy(p_mad_addr->gid, h->dport.gid, 16); in sa_query()
|
H A D | ibaddr.c | 59 ibmad_gid_t gid; in ib_resolve_addr() local 74 mad_encode_field(gid, IB_GID_PREFIX_F, &prefix); in ib_resolve_addr() 75 mad_encode_field(gid, IB_GID_GUID_F, &guid); in ib_resolve_addr() 78 printf("GID %s ", inet_ntop(AF_INET6, gid, gid_str, in ib_resolve_addr()
|
/freebsd/sys/contrib/openzfs/module/os/linux/zfs/ |
H A D | policy.c | 217 secpolicy_vnode_setids_setgids(const cred_t *cr, gid_t gid, zidmap_t *mnt_ns, in secpolicy_vnode_setids_setgids() argument 220 gid = zfs_gid_to_vfsgid(mnt_ns, fs_ns, gid); in secpolicy_vnode_setids_setgids() 222 if (!kgid_has_mapping(cr->user_ns, SGID_TO_KGID(gid))) in secpolicy_vnode_setids_setgids() 225 if (crgetgid(cr) != gid && !groupmember(gid, cr)) in secpolicy_vnode_setids_setgids()
|
/freebsd/usr.bin/wall/ |
H A D | wall.c | 64 gid_t gid; member 109 g->gid = -1; in main() 124 g->gid = grp->gr_gid; in main() 145 if (g->gid == (gid_t)-1) in main() 147 if (g->gid == pw->pw_gid) in main() 149 else if ((grp = getgrgid(g->gid)) != NULL) { in main()
|
/freebsd/tools/regression/sysvshm/ |
H A D | shmtest.c | 226 gid_t gid = getegid(); in print_shmid_ds() local 229 sp->shm_perm.uid, sp->shm_perm.gid, in print_shmid_ds() 248 if (sp->shm_perm.gid != gid || sp->shm_perm.cgid != gid) in print_shmid_ds()
|
/freebsd/contrib/libpcap/testprogs/ |
H A D | visopts.py | 238 gid = 1 267 with file("expr1_g%03d.svg" % (gid), "wt") as f: 271 gid += 1 282 write_html(expr, gid - 1, logs)
|
/freebsd/sbin/mknod/ |
H A D | mknod.c | 101 gid_t gid; in main() local 138 uid = gid = -1; in main() 143 gid = a_gid(cp); in main() 152 if (chown(argv[1], uid, gid)) in main()
|
/freebsd/contrib/lib9p/backend/ |
H A D | fs.c | 1116 gid_t gid; in fs_icreate() local 1306 gid_t gid; in fs_imkdir() local 1367 gid_t gid; in fs_imknod() local 1426 gid_t gid; in fs_imkfifo() local 1473 gid_t gid; in fs_imksocket() local 1580 gid_t gid; in fs_isymlink() local 2183 gid = req->lr_req.tlopen.gid; in fs_lopen() 2212 gid = req->lr_req.tlcreate.gid; in fs_lcreate() 2232 gid = req->lr_req.tsymlink.gid; in fs_symlink() 2253 gid = req->lr_req.tmknod.gid; in fs_mknod() [all …]
|
/freebsd/contrib/ofed/libibverbs/examples/ |
H A D | xsrq_pingpong.c | 64 union ibv_gid gid; member 387 char gid[33]; in send_local_dest() local 408 inet_ntop(AF_INET6, &local_gid, gid, sizeof(gid)); in send_local_dest() 411 srq_num, gid); in send_local_dest() 413 gid_to_wire_gid(&local_gid, gid); in send_local_dest() 416 srq_num, gid); in send_local_dest() 430 char gid[33]; in recv_remote_dest() local 449 wire_gid_to_gid(gid, &rem_dest->gid); in recv_remote_dest() 450 inet_ntop(AF_INET6, &rem_dest->gid, gid, sizeof(gid)); in recv_remote_dest() 453 gid); in recv_remote_dest() [all …]
|
/freebsd/contrib/mtree/ |
H A D | getid.c | 165 gi_getgrgid(gid_t gid) in gi_getgrgid() argument 171 rval = grscan(1, gid, NULL); in gi_getgrgid() 219 grscan(int search, gid_t gid, const char *name) in grscan() argument 241 if (grmatchline(search, gid, name)) in grscan() 248 grmatchline(int search, gid_t gid, const char *name) in grmatchline() argument 268 if (search && name == NULL && _gr_group.gr_gid != gid) in grmatchline()
|
/freebsd/crypto/heimdal/kcm/ |
H A D | config.c | 166 gid_t gid = 0; in parse_owners() local 188 gid = pw->pw_gid; gid_p = 1; in parse_owners() 201 gid = gr->gr_gid; gid_p = 1; in parse_owners() 210 ccache->gid = gid; in parse_owners() 212 ccache->gid = 0; /* getegid() XXX */ in parse_owners()
|
/freebsd/tools/regression/sysvsem/ |
H A D | semtest.c | 281 gid_t gid = getegid(); in print_semid_ds() local 284 sp->sem_perm.uid, sp->sem_perm.gid, in print_semid_ds() 300 if (sp->sem_perm.gid != gid || sp->sem_perm.cgid != gid) in print_semid_ds()
|
/freebsd/contrib/llvm-project/lldb/include/lldb/Utility/ |
H A D | UserIDResolver.h | 31 std::optional<llvm::StringRef> GetGroupName(id_t gid) { in GetGroupName() argument 32 return Get(gid, m_gid_cache, &UserIDResolver::DoGetGroupName); in GetGroupName() 41 virtual std::optional<std::string> DoGetGroupName(id_t gid) = 0;
|
/freebsd/contrib/pjdfstest/tests/chown/ |
H A D | 09.t | 23 expect 65534,65534 stat ${n0}/${n1} uid,gid 26 expect 65534,65534 stat ${n0}/${n1} uid,gid 29 expect 65533,65533 stat ${n0}/${n1} uid,gid
|